I'm excited to announce that I have been cast to play Rudolph Valentino in an upcoming movie. Rudolph Valentino was a very famous actor in Hollywood's silent film era. He was born in 1895 in southern Italy, and died in 1926, when he was only 31 years old.

He was a huge star. At his funeral in Manhatten, over 100,000 people lined the streets to pay their respects. A riot erupted and horse mounted police had to restore order. A second funeral was held in Beverly Hills. Rudolph Valentino is the most visited grave in the famous Hollywood Forever Cemetery.
